The American Foundation for Suicide Prevention (AFSP) North Texas Chapter presents a brief introduction to suicide prevention.


We will cover what we know about this leading cause of death, the most up-to-date research on prevention, and what we can all do to fight suicide. Participants will learn the common risk factors for suicide, how to spot the warning signs in others, and how to keep ourselves, our loved one, our professional networks, and those in our community safe.


Key Statistics:

  • In Texas, suicide is the 10th leading cause of death with 4,193 deaths in 2021.
  • In Texas, suicide is the 2nd leading cause of death for ages 10-34 and the 4th leading cause of death for ages 35-44.
  • In the US in 2021, the rate of suicide deaths was 14.1 for every 100,000 in population.
  • In the US in 2021, the rates of suicide deaths for those in the Construction & Extraction (Mining, Oil & Gas) Industries were 49.4 per 100,000 men and 25.5 per 100,000 women – almost 2-3x the rate of the general population – making it the industry with the highest suicide rates.
